Sudden nausea??


I got really lucky, as the ENTIRE morning sickness thing bypassed me but in the last three days, Im very, very nauseaus and my appetite is way off..the only thing I can stomach is kiwi and sugar free jello. She has dropped waay down, so it cant be that my stomach is getting cramped. Ive heard that nausea is a sign of impending labor..what do you guys think?
